Define Bone Remodeling - Correct answer-The process of mature bone adding and
removing from the thickness of bone
What are the four stages of bone repair? - Correct answer-1. Hematoma formation
2. Soft callus formation
3. Hard callus formation
4. Bone remodeling
What are the known functions of the skeletal system? - Correct answer-Provides
support
Protects the internal organs
Assists with body movement
Calcium homeostasis
Participates in blood cell production
Stores triglycerides

,What type of bone is the pelvic bones? - Correct answer-Irregular
What type of bone is the ribs? - Correct answer-Flat
What type of bone is the metacarpal bones? - Correct answer-Long
What type of bone is the humerus? - Correct answer-Long
What type of bone is the carpal bones? - Correct answer-Short
What type of bone is the clavicle? - Correct answer-Long
What type of bone is the sternum? - Correct answer-Flat
What type of bone is the vertebrae? - Correct answer-Irregular
What type of bone is the fibula? - Correct answer-Long
The outer covering of bone that helps regulate bone thickness is known as the
_________. - Correct answer-Periosteum
The two ends of a long bone are known as the ______. - Correct answer-Epiphysis
What occurs during endochondral ossification? - Correct answer-Calcification
Cartilage is replaced by bone

Functions of the skin - Correct answer-Protection
Excretion
Detects touch
Maintains the body temperature
Synthesizes vitamin D
Stores lipids
The shaft of the long bone is known as ______. - Correct answer-Diaphysis
What can cause bones to become weak, fragile, and porous? - Correct answer-
Prolonged period of inactivity
Define the movement of the synarthrotic joint - Correct answer-Immovable joint
Define the movement of the amphiarthrotic joint - Correct answer-Slightly
movable joint
Define the movement of the diarthrotic joint - Correct answer-Freely movable joint
